    The search term mentioning a specific "4939 min install" is a major red flag. Security experts recommend the following:

    Do Not Download: Never click on links or "install" buttons from unverified third-party websites claiming to host private "live shows."

    Scan Your Device: If you have already interacted with such a link or downloaded a file, run an immediate virus scan using reputable software.

    Use Official Channels: Only view content through established platforms like Instagram, YouTube, or Facebook to ensure your personal data remains secure.

    When you see a search result asking you to "install" an app to view a specific video, you should proceed with caution. Many of these prompts lead to third-party streaming apps that may:

    Request excessive permissions (access to your contacts, camera, or mic). Contain aggressive advertisements or malware.

    Be unofficial mirrors of content originally posted on platforms like Facebook Live or Moj.
